CVE-2026-1101
Last modified
CVE-2026-1101 is a medium-severity vulnerability rated 6.5/10 on the CVSS scale. GitLab has remediated an issue in GitLab EE affecting all versions from 18.2 before 18.8.9, 18.9 before 18.9.5, and 18.10 before 18.10.3 that could have allowed an authenticated user to cause denial of service to the GitLab instance due to improper input validation in GraphQL queries.. EPSS estimates a 0.41%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
